How does CBD affect the human body?

The human brain produces cannabinoids itself. These are very similar to the cannabinoids found in the cannabis plant. The brain produces cannabinoids through the so-called endocannabinoid system. This system regulates important bodily functions, including the immune system.

The cannabinoids that your brain produces itself interact with certain receptors in the body. These receptors are located, among other things, in the central nervous system and the immune system and connect with the cannabinoids. There is an effect in the body, such as killing a cell or stopping inflammation.

Two different receptors play a role in the use of CBD drops:
  • CB1 receptors are mainly located in the brain, but also in the liver, kidneys and lungs.
  • CB2 receptors are mainly located in the immune system.

When you ingest cannabinoids from the cannabis plant, it interacts with specific receptors in the body, just as you would with your own cannabinoids. Every cannabinoid in the cannabis plant is different and interacts with the receptors in a different way. So, this leads to different effects in the body.

CBD is quite unique and works differently from most cannabinoids. Research has shown that it does not interact with receptors in the same way as most other cannabinoids. Rather, it hardly connects to the receptors and ensures that they function optimally.

Anxiety and stress

Everyone has stress from time to time. Think of an important appointment, exams, a lost love, the covid-19 virus, graduation stress, a sick family member or long and busy working days.
Initially, CBD was mainly known as an application for the relief of stress and anxiety complaints. In 2011, scientists published an article in the Journal of Psychopharmacology in response to a study of the relationship between CBD and social anxiety disorders. It suggests that CBD can provide relief for people with an anxiety disorder. Another study from the same year found that preventive administration of CBD to public speakers significantly reduced their anxiety, stress, and discomfort. Sleep problems

Good sleep is not only important to function properly, but also to prevent health damage. Chronically poor sleep increases the risk of getting diseases and disorders. But poor sleep also causes reduced energy, concentration and memory problems and irritability. It is mainly the women who have sleeping problems, according to recent research. Women generally sleep a little longer than men, but fall asleep more difficult, have more trouble sleeping and use more sleep medication than men.

The many disadvantages of sleeping pills are well known. It is not for nothing that GPs are careful to prescribe sleeping pills, because you get used to them quickly. Although they can help you to sleep better for one or a few days, sleep aids also have many disadvantages: they also have side effects such as daytime drowsiness and concentration problems and they increase the risk of falling, especially in the elderly. The cannabinoids from hemp support the body's own endocannabinoid level. This ensures that you fall asleep more easily, sleep longer and that the sleep quality improves.

In addition, the CBD affects the entire sleep cycle; it increases the deep third stage of sleep and decreases the duration of the brake sleep. The third stage of sleep is said to be the most important stage for those suffering from a sleep disorder. A shorter period of REM sleep has been associated with a reduction in symptoms of depression. Many CBD users also report that they sleep more relaxed and sleep better and are less tired during the day, which benefits their energy levels.

Memory

The importance of a strong, functional memory is something that is often overlooked, but without its life would be a lot more difficult. Every skill we've learned over time has been preserved by memory. There are a number of neurodegenerative diseases associated with the endocannabinoid system - Huntington's disease, and Parkinson's disease, are some of the most common. It is thought that when the body's cannabinoids interact with the CB1 and CB2 receptors, they affect the release of neurochemicals in the brain, which in turn affect how brain cells communicate with each other.
In addition to affecting the interaction of the brain cells, thereby reducing the deterioration of brain functioning, CBD is also thought to further improve the symptoms of dementia by reducing inflammation and oxygen accumulation in the brain. It can also reduce the stress and anxiety symptoms often experienced by a patient with dementia. Multiple reports are promising and hopefully further research will help us further understand how it works.
